Job Title: Assistant Site Manager – Bristol Outskirts
Location: Bristol (Outskirts)
Pay Rate: £250/day (CIS)
Contract Length: Minimum 4 months, potential to extend until June 2025

Our client is looking for an experienced Assistant Site Manager to join their construction team on a £10 million commercial scheme located just outside Bristol. This role is ideal for someone with a strong background in civil works, who can manage day-to-day site operations and maintain high standards of quality control.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Oversee subcontractors and ensure all work meets project specifications
  • Use Fieldview to capture and report on project progress, ensuring alignment with technical drawings
  • Take control of Daily Dabs, ensuring effective daily operations and task management
  • Ensure adherence to health and safety standards and project deadlines

Key Requirements:

  • Experience in civil works is essential, even though this is a commercial project
  • Ability to understand and work from technical drawings, ensuring details are captured and referenced in Fieldview
  • Strong organisational and communication skills
  • Previous experience in a similar role is preferred

Contract Details:

  • Initial contract for 4 months, with the potential to extend until June 2025
  • £250/day, payable via CIS
